APOL1 is a secreted high density lipoprotein which binds to apolipoprotein A-I.
Apolipoprotein A-I is a relatively abundant plasma protein and is the major apoprotein of HDL.
It is involved in the formation of most cholesteryl esters in plasma and also promotes efflux of cholesterol from cells.
This apolipoprotein L family member may play a role in lipid exchange and transport throughout the body, as well as in reverse cholesterol transport from peripheral cells to the liver.
